Is ThunderCats on Peacock?
How to watch ThunderCats on Peacock
*or all of the other ways to watch ThunderCats.
Learn more about when/if Peacock has ThunderCats >>
How to watch ThunderCats on Peacock
*or all of the other ways to watch ThunderCats.
Learn more about when/if Peacock has ThunderCats >>